Minutes — Management Meeting, Reseller Programme Review. Fenwick Dray summarised performance of the Quillmark reseller tier: margins stable, onboarding slow. Agreed actions: simplify certification, consolidate the partner portal, and pause new recruitment in the eastern region pending review. The incoming director will own these items from next month. Forward plans for the programme are captured in the confidential note below.

management briefing: Project Ulavan slips by two quarters because of the staffing delay.

Handover — Skyfall fan-out, week of the 14th

Dara — taking over from me. Current state: fan-out stable, but two support-visible issues remain. One: coastal-region subscribers occasionally get duplicate severe-weather pushes; dedupe fix is merged, ships next release. Two: a handful of tickets about delayed flood alerts — traced to a slow regional shard, mitigated, watch it. If support escalates, ask for the alert ID and region first. Paging thresholds unchanged. Full ticket log and shard status are on the internal page below.

operations page: https://jenkins.zemvarcloud.local/job/merge_requests/repo/build/73930b4b30f0a8ed

**Nightly reindex: Searchmere pipeline**

The nightly reindex rebuilds all Searchmere shards from the canonical document store, then swaps aliases atomically once validation passes. For the release manager: the job must not overlap a deploy window, because alias swaps during a rolling restart can briefly serve a stale shard. We gate the swap on a document-count delta check and a sampled relevance probe. If either fails, the old index stays live and the job retries once. The constants governing batching and backoff are as follows.

tuning table, kajog-kawef:
PRIORITIES = {
    "kelox": 870,
    "kasix": 89,
    "eliax": 988,
}

## Deploying BranchReaper

Quick heads-up for review: BranchReaper (our stale-branch cleanup bot at Molliner Labs) ships as a container, and the registry only admits signed images. Deletion scopes are read-limited until the dry-run flag clears. Nothing exotic here, but please eyeball the permissions manifest. Images are signed with the key below.

signing key of bagap-yawep = bky13_TbfT6ZMUoGJo2